Summary

Vulnerability in Oracle BI Publisher (Administration component) affecting versions 8.2.0.0.0, 12.2.1.4.0 and 26.01.0.0.0. A low privileged attacker with network access via HTTP can gain unauthorized access to and modify data, requiring user interaction. CVSS 3.1 Base Score 7.6.

Risk Assessment

Risk of leakage and modification of reporting data by a low-privileged user, with potential impact on additional products.

Recommendation

Apply Oracle CPU patches and train users on phishing awareness, as human interaction is required.

Original NVD description (English source)

Vulnerability in the Oracle BI Publisher product of Oracle Analytics (component: Administration). Supported versions that are affected are 8.2.0.0.0, 12.2.1.4.0 and 26.01.0.0.0. Easily exploitable vulnerability allows low privileged attacker with network access via HTTP to compromise Oracle BI Publisher. Successful attacks require human interaction from a person other than the attacker and while the vulnerability is in Oracle BI Publisher, attacks may significantly impact additional products (scope change).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in unauthorized access to critical data or complete access to all Oracle BI Publisher accessible data as well as unauthorized update, insert or delete access to some of Oracle BI Publisher accessible data. CVSS 3.1 Base Score 7.6 (Confidentiality and Integrity impacts). CVSS Vector: (C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:R/S:C/C:H/I:L/A:N).
